    Abstract: A control apparatus for a reformer and a method of controlling the reformer are provided. The reformer gasifies a reformate fuel by a reforming reaction, supplies the obtained reformate gas to an energy converter to convert the reformate gas into energy of another form, and heats the reformate fuel by burning emission containing unreacted flammable gas produced in the energy converter. The control apparatus comprises a reforming amount assessing device for assessing the amount of the reformate fuel to be gasified, and an emission amount assessing device for assessing the amount of emission to be supplied into the reformer on the basis of the assessed amount of reformate fuel. When using the unreacted hydrogen gas generated in a fuel cell for heating the reformate fuel, the unreacted hydrogen gas and combustion aid gas can be controlled so that the reformate fuel is heated properly.

    Abstract: A control apparatus can maintain a substantially constant temperature of a reforming reaction in which a partial oxidation reaction occurs. The control apparatus can be used for a reformer that reforms reformats fuel into fuel by an endothermic reforming reaction and a partial oxidation reforming reaction. The amount of oxygen supplied for the partial oxidation reaction is determined based on an amount of the raw material and on theoretical endothermic values and exothermic values of the respective reforming reaction and partial oxidation reaction.

    Abstract: Acceleration detecting sensor (60) is provided in a sprung structure (50), while a vibration model comprising the sprung mass of a vehicle, the spring, and the shock absorber is previously stored in control unit (58). The deviation of the detected acceleration from the estimated vertical acceleration of the sprung structure is computed by a control unit (58) and then amplified. The vertical acceleration of the sprung structure and the relative velocity between sprung and unsprung structures are estimated by a control unit (58) according to the amplified deviation and the vibration model. The stored vibration model has one degree of freedom and a simple structure.
